FOB Chandel organises ICOP on Azadi Ka Amrit Mahotsav
Source: The Sangai Express
Chandel, November 28 2021:
Field Outreach Bureau, Chandel under the Ministry of Information & Broadcasting organised an Integrated Communication & Outreach Programme (ICOP) on Azadi Ka Amrit Mahotsav at Monsang Pantha Village Community Hall, Chandel district today.
It was attended by Mothil Saka, SDC Chandel HQ; Ng Vincent Monsang, chief/chairman; and Dr Willson, Food Safety Officer Chandel as presidium members.
The programme began with an invocation prayer by Ng Johnson, Diploma Catechist.
Speaking on the occasion, Ng Vincent Monsang stated that Azadi Ka Amrit Mahotsav is an initiative of the Government of India to celebrate and commemorate 75 years of progressive India.
Mothil Saka stressed on the importance of Azadi Ka Amrit Mahotsav and urged the people to identify historical forest, lakes, monuments, etc and report to the Government for survey.
Dr Willson elaborated on how the Europeans came and started settling in India through the British East India Company.
He also enlightened the gathering on the struggle for India's freedom from 1857 to 1947 and the role of various Manipur freedom fighters in India's freedom struggle.
The programme was also participated by M/S Achouba Artist Association, Singjamei Chinga Makha, Imphal West District.
Later, a quiz competition was also conducted and prizes distributed.
The ICOP concluded with a vote of thanks by Ng Micky Victor Monsang, Ningthou of the village.
Ng Salim, president MPYCC, was the moderator of the programme.
